WebOct 29, 2024 · Test #1: Pain with Standing Twist. Stand behind a chair on the injured leg. Make sure to keep your knee slightly bent and not locked backward. Using the chair for support, gently twist your hips back and forth. Your knee should help stabilize you, however, if this produces pain it is a likely sign you have a torn meniscus. solving an initial value problem

WebJun 15, 2024 · 2. Swelling around the joint: Swelling is also one of the most common symptoms of a torn ligament. You will see that the joint swelling has taken place and the temperature is also slightly high. This high temperature around the joint is a sign that there is something wrong with the joint or the ligament and it calls for a doctor’s attention. WebMar 18, 2024 · Signs of a Meniscus Tear in Dogs. Tears of the menisci can derive from repeated trauma causing tears that can be partial or complete. The tell-tale sign of a meniscus injury is a clicking noise heard sometimes as the dog walks and during physical examination when the vet moves the joint (drawer motion or stifle flexion).
